## Runbook: Schemary registry restarts

Schemary holds every event schema for the Dovetail pipeline. On restart it replays the compatibility log, which can take a few minutes — don't panic if health checks flap briefly. Never delete a subject without confirming no consumer pins that version. After any restart, verify the node came up with these configuration values.

settings of yahaf-tahop:
jorox:
  pin: 5851
  tenant: noveth
  seal: seal_7ddb5c42
  metrics_host: metrics.jorox.ordinnet.example
  standby_team: wenax
  escalation: oliath-feneth
  nonce: 552548

## Migration step 4: move Gridsmith to the new fill engine

The legacy crossword generator service is frozen. Point your build at the new fill engine before running any puzzle batches. Word-list paths changed, and the symmetry checker is now a separate worker — don't skip it or fills will fail validation silently. Clear the old pattern cache first. Once that's done, update the engine's settings file to match the values below.

service settings:
[druvan]
port = 8000
team = gorir
host = druvan.paliqworks.corp
region = central-1
access_code = ac_0d333e
timeout_ms = 1000

Visitors to the Kestrel prototype workshop at Dunmore Works must be pre-registered and accompanied at all times. Reception should issue a red lanyard, confirm photo ID, and log entry and exit times. Photography is not permitted inside the workshop. If the escorting engineer is delayed, visitors wait in the atrium. The workshop door code for escorts is below.

staff pass of kahop-kadup = bdg-NCCCQ-99141

# --- Eventspine Schema Registry settings ---
# Hey release crew: this block controls where the registry stashes
# event schemas during a cut. Don't touch the compatibility mode
# (it's BACKWARD for a reason — ask anyone who survived the v3 rollout).
# If you're promoting schemas from staging to prod, bump the snapshot
# flag below and the registry will mirror everything automatically.
# One thing that MUST be set before the release train leaves: the
# registry's backing store. The connection string it uses is the following.

primary connection of yagep-kahip = redis://giliel_svc:zYiKsLL2PLpfPL@db-348f.xolmarsys.corp:5432/fenwyn